Output 6d9fd8e5ce2ed93d4a8eb7ea0a1fcab068fb6caaa2be7926d07a5119e0f0c3f7:2

value
21405330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ff37629c694652473cf17f5d6d1bdf0f66983d85 OP_EQUAL
address
3QxUah4qMsXfaY8DL3dDQdK1N52rF9vDWt
transaction
6d9fd8e5ce2ed93d4a8eb7ea0a1fcab068fb6caaa2be7926d07a5119e0f0c3f7
confirmations
460272
spent
true